IntelliJ IDEA is a special programming environment or integrated development environment (IDE) largely meant for Java. This environment is used especially for the development of programs. It is developed by a company called JetBrains, which was formally called IntelliJ. It is one of the best programming tools based on Java because of its assistance features, which makes it easy to use.
